KiniKakes said:Whenever i would get a sew-in in the past, I would let someone else cut it out for me..... either a girlfriend or the stylist. There is NO WAY i would have attempted to cut it out myself. THe thread is black, so i couldnt distinguish it from my own hair. Plus, i just cant see on the top/sides of my hair, even if the thread was bright yellow. I would have DEFINITELY ended up cutting some of my own hair out with the track.
My suggestion is that u find a girlfriend who is patient..... get some tiny little scissors and/or thread ripper........ and let her spend the afternoon taking the tracks out. Make sure you sit in good lighting.
prettypuff1 said:I cut them out my self. just run ur finger under the track. as soon as you hit a bump or something that stops your finger, its the thread. I would lift up the track and cut the string CAREFULLY or half your progress with be on the floor
